The Role
This position centres on leading forensic investigations into cyberattacks and economic crime, managing incident response engagements, and conducting in-depth digital and cyber forensic analyses. The role also involves developing innovative service offerings and contributing to business development and recruiting activities.
Skills & Experience
Candidates should bring proven expertise in cyber incident response, computer forensics methodologies, and the specialist tools used to investigate cybercrime. Experience managing complex forensic projects independently is essential, along with a strong understanding of modern technologies applied within digital and cyber forensics practice.

Typical advertised salary for Digital Forensics roles in Germany: €51,000–€74,000 (median €51,000 — from 13 recent listings analysed by Forensic Focus).
